免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 1254 | 回复: 3
打印 上一主题 下一主题

[DNS] 问:在没有compiler 的aix上 装BIND 8 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2004-10-30 23:28 |只看该作者 |倒序浏览
各位大大,最近我要在aix 4.3.3 上build BIND 8.4.5 。 但找不到方法把compile好的 bind.  移到另一部没有compiler 的 aix 上 make install.  

把 src 下的移到另一部没有compiler 的 aix上 make install是不行的。基本上bind 8 的檔也不在src下。

网上有说有binary install 的 方 法 。 但真的找不到。而我也不能用网上binary 的package。

有说,可把bind 8.4.5 build 到自定的文件檔案目录下,打包再在别机上还完,但不知如何作?
是否不是用make stdlinks 而是用其它的参数呢?

还有其它的方法吗?如在aix自作package?

有大大曾有这方面的经验吗, 如可以的话, 请各位详述赐教赐教, 在此先谢过!

论坛徽章:
1
荣誉版主
日期:2011-11-23 16:44:17
2 [报告]
发表于 2004-10-31 08:15 |只看该作者

问:在没有compiler 的aix上 装BIND 8

1、我对 aix 不了解,但一般每一种 unix 都有自己软件包安装机制,你可以尝试一下找找 aix 的 bind binary package。
2、或你可以先在有编译器的 aix 上编译 bind,在 configure 时使用 --prefix=/usr/local/bind 选项,将 bind 安装在一个单独的目录。编译安装完成后,你将 /usr/local/bind 目录 tar 成一个单独的包,然后传到没有编译器的 aix 上,解开 tar 包到 /usr/local 就行。

论坛徽章:
0
3 [报告]
发表于 2004-10-31 11:33 |只看该作者

问:在没有compiler 的aix上 装BIND 8

谢谢版主。

但我在bind 8.4.5 的文件找不到configure 的方法。

跟据bind 8.4.5 的文件,所有的安装用make进行。
make stdlinks
make clean  
make depend
make   

不知版主及各位有没有这方面的经验或资料。可否详述赐教

真的很想知
在此再谢过!

论坛徽章:
1
荣誉版主
日期:2011-11-23 16:44:17
4 [报告]
发表于 2004-10-31 12:05 |只看该作者

问:在没有compiler 的aix上 装BIND 8

一般在 Unix 下通过源代码安装软件包时有三步曲:
1、configure // 针对特定环境生成 MakeFile
2、make // 编译
3、make install // 真正安装编译好的文件
但这不是绝对的,安装包一般都有附带类似 README 或 INSTALL 的安装说明。

我不知道你的源代码安装包是从哪里下载的,你可以到 www.isc.org 去下载 bind 8 的源代码包。还有建议查看一下 aix 的编译器的说明文档。因为我这边使用的 solaris 和 Linux ,都是使用免费的 gcc ,不知道 aix 使用的编译器为何。(solaris 也有自己的编译器,但要钱购买,所以就没用)
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P